Chem 134 Ch16.(Acid Base Equilibria)
1) According to the Arrhenius concept, an acid is a substance that __________.
A) is capable of donating one or more H+
B) causes an increase in the concentration of H+ in aqueous solutions
C) can accept a pair of electrons to form a coordinate covalent bond
D) reacts with the solvent to form the cation formed by autoionization of that solvent
E) tastes bitter - answerB
2) A BrOMnsted-Lowry base is defined as a substance that __________.
A) increases [H+] when placed in H2O
B) decreases [H+] when placed in H2O
C) increases [OH-] when placed in H2O
D) acts as a proton acceptor
E) acts as a proton donor - answerD
3) What is the conjugate acid of NH3?
A) NH3
B) NH2+
C) NH3+
D) NH4+
E) NH4OH - answerD
4) What is the conjugate base of OH-?
A) O2
B) O-
C) H2O
D) O2-
E) H3O+ - answerD
5) Which one of the following cannot act as a Lewis base?
A) Cl-
B) NH3
C) BF3
D) CN-
E) H2O - answerC
6) In the reaction
BF3 + F- ¬ BF4-
BF3 acts as a(n) __________ acid.
A) Arrhenius
, B) BrOMnsted-Lowry
C) Lewis
D) Arrhenius, BrMnsted-Lowry, and Lewis
E) Arrhenius and BrMnsted-Lowry - answerC
7) Of the following, the acid strength of __________ is the greatest.
A) CH3COOH
B) ClCH2COOH
C) Cl2CHCOOH
D) Cl3CCOOH
E) BrCH2COOH - answerD
8) Of the following, which is the strongest acid?
A) HClO
B) HF
C) HBr
D) HI
E) HCl - answerD
9) The molar concentration of hydronium ion in pure water at 25eC is __________.
A) 0.00
B) 1.0 * 10^-7
C) 1.0 * 10^-14
D) 1.00
E) 7.00 - answerB
10) The magnitude of Kw indicates that __________ .
A) water autoionizes very slowly
B) water autoionizes very quickly
C) water autoionizes only to a very small extent
D) the autoionization of water is exothermic
E) the autoionization of water is endothermic - answerC
11) What is the pH of a 0.015-M aqueous solution of barium hydroxide?
A) 12.48
B) 12.18
C) 1.82
D) 10.35
E) 1.52 - answerA
12) An aqueous solution contains 0.10 M NaOH. The solution is ____________.
A) very dilute
B) highly colored
C) basic
D) neutral
E) acidic - answerC
